    Rand Paul says seizure of oil tankers in Caribbean a ‘prelude to war’

    Team_Prime US NewsBy Team_Prime US NewsDecember 21,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


    Republican Sen. Rand Paul on Sunday criticized President Donald Trump’s military mission off Venezuela’s coast, calling the seizures of a number of oil tankers within the Caribbean Sea “a provocation and a prelude to warfare.”

    “I am not for confiscating these liners. I am not for blowing up these boats of unarmed individuals which might be suspected of being drug sellers. I am not for any of this,” Paul informed ABC Information’ “This Week” co-anchor Jonathan Karl. 

    Paul additionally described the administration’s coverage of dealing with suspected drug traffickers as “weird and contradictory.”

    “After which why is the previous president [Juan Orlando] Hernandez of Honduras, who was in jail for 45 years, why is he launched?” Paul requested. “So, some narco-terrorists are actually OK and different narco-terrorists we will blow up. After which a few of them, if they don’t seem to be designated as a terrorist, we’d arrest them.”

    Listed below are extra highlights from Paul’s interview:

    On Erika Kirk and Marco Rubio’s 2028 Vance endorsement

    Karl: Is JD Vance the inheritor obvious right here?

    Paul: I feel there must be representatives within the Republican Occasion who nonetheless consider worldwide commerce is sweet, who nonetheless consider in free market capitalism, who nonetheless consider in low taxes. See, it used to separate conservatives and liberals that conservatives thought it was a spending drawback. We did not need extra income. We needed much less spending. However now all these professional terror protectionists, they love taxes, and they also tax, tax, tax, after which they brag about all of the income coming in. That has by no means been a conservative place. So I will proceed to attempt to lead a conservative free market wing of the occasion, and we’ll see the place issues lead over time.

    Karl: And that is not JD Vance. 

    Paul: No. 

    On retaliatory strikes in Syria

    Paul: , it is exhausting to not need to hit again once they kill a few of our personal. However I wish to return, actually, to the primary Trump administration when he mentioned he did not need the troops there. There’s like 900 troops, perhaps a thousand, perhaps 1,500. They are not sufficient to combat a warfare. They are not sufficient to be an efficient strategic drive. What they’re is a goal and a tripwire. 

    So we have completed this retaliatory strike. Now, now, Donald Trump must do what Donald Trump proposed within the first administration, what Ronald Reagan did after the 1983 bomb. He left. There is not any purpose for us to be in Syria. We have to depart Syria and never be a visit wire to getting again concerned in one other warfare. 

    On the potential for a one-year extension for ACA subsidies

    Paul: Look, we’ve got health care in our nation for poor individuals. It is known as Medicaid. All the relaxation of these items has not labored. Obamacare has been a failure. President Obama mentioned it could deliver premiums down. Premiums gone by means of the roof. Each time we give extra subsidies, the premiums go greater. I’ve a plan that claims all people on this market, and it is solely about 4%, all people on this market ought to be capable of go to Amazon or Costco or Sam’s Membership and as a gaggle, a big group — thousands and thousands of individuals within the group — negotiate with Massive Insurance coverage to deliver costs down. It is the one proposal on the market that — that has an opportunity of bringing costs down.
